Walter White clearly wasn't spending his earned character points on successes, because he kept growing in power during his adventures. So if we are to assume that every session, he bought a few successes with points, that means that he had a store of several hundred points at the start of play for that purpose. Destiny and Wildcard skills are very fitting for many fictional protagonists, but they are usually not cheap enough for a truly low point character to make use of them. For a 25-point character, a mere 10 point Destinty or a few points in a Wildcard skill (which is then no higher than 7), without having any adventurer skills at more than 4-6, his defaults from normal people attributes, is not going to be enough if he's going to survive a standard season of popular television.

Depends what you're going for. If you're going for something like drama system perhaps you want to use GURPS to resolve procedural scenes. Maybe you earn your wild card points from the drama scenes. Or maybe you start with a bank and try not to waste them instead relying on the dramatic scenes with other PCs. Maybe you make GURPS more like Gumshoe with a point pool. Maybe you go pointless with 250 point characters in the same series as 75 point ones. Maybe that doesn't matter because the dramatic characters get to use a wildcard point pool. There's a lot of ways to come at a problem. I think WW probably started at sub 75 and went up fast. But IIRC he probably doesn't make too many critical skill checks in series one. |
